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Maghull North to South Croydon start from as little as £43.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Maghull North is designed to cater to all passengers with complete step-free access throughout the station. This modern facility offers well-equipped services including staff help and customer information points available every day. While there are no ticket machines, there is a ticket office where travelers can collect tickets purchased online. Notably, smartcards are issued at the station, and convenient validation points are available.

Conveniences When You Travel

Whether you need some assistance during your journey or a quick refreshment, Maghull North covers most everyday needs. There’s step-free access available to all platforms via lifts, ensuring easy movement across the station. While the station doesn't have shops or ATMs, it provides essential facilities like baby changing and toilets. Secure cycling storage is available for eco-conscious travelers, though there isn't the facility to hire bikes directly at the station.

Transport Connectivity

The station is well-integrated with varied transport links to ease your onward journey. Though there isn't a taxi rank, local bus services are readily accessible. For travelers heading to Liverpool John Lennon Airport, the combination of train and bus tickets simplifies the journey, ensuring a hassle-free travel experience. Rail replacement services stop at nearby School Lane, adding yet another convenient travel option.

Station Details and Facilities

The station boasts a well-organized ticketing system, with the ticket office open from 06:20 to 19:45 on weekdays and Saturdays, and shortened hours on Sundays. Ticket machines are available for quick transactions, and you can easily collect tickets that were purchased online. Accessibility is a priority with smartcard validators and machines that apply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. However, do note that the station isn't fully step-free, which may require checking the station map for step-free access details beforehand.

For those traveling with a disability, support is readily available. While there is no ramp for train access, assistance can be pre-booked, or sought spontaneously if station staff are present. Information points and induction loops add to the convenience. CCTV ensures security throughout the premises, giving peace of mind to travelers.

Comfort and Convenience

While the station does not feature a waiting room, it offers a seating area for those in need of a respite. However, travelers should plan ahead for snacks and financial needs as there are no shops, refreshment facilities, or ATMs available on-site. Nevertheless, ample parking, including free spaces, and bicycle storage with CCTV coverage provide added convenience for local commuters.

Accessibility and Parking

Those looking to drive to the station can benefit from an 80-space car park managed by APCOA Parking UK, which is open 24/7. While there are no accessible car park facilities, there are two accessible spaces and a provision for an impaired mobility set-down/pick-up point. The station's CCTV-monitored bicycle racks are positioned on either side of the main entrance.
